This week on The KORE Women podcast Dr. summer Watson welcomes Dr. Kellie Stecher, who is an Author, Educator, Policy Consultant, and OBGYN at M Health Fairview Women’s Center in Edinaand Co-Founder and President of Patient Care Heroes, Founding Board Member for the Minnesota Branch of the League of Minority Voters, as well as the Governor of the 7th district of the American Medical Women’s Association.
She has won the Minneapolis/St. Paul Magazine’s Top Doctors' Rising Star award for the last three years. She launched an organization, Patient Care Heroes, a community of leaders and innovators who are willing to go the extra mile and put service ahead of their personal needs. This organization was created with love and compassion as a way to provide assistance to the families and loved ones of physicians, nurses, medical assistants, dentists, EMS, and others, who have died in the medical community. The country has suffered a collective trauma and there is a need to grieve together, this organization will create a hub where that can occur.
